Property crime — Sawtell vs NSW
Break-ins to homes
422.4 incidents per 100,000 residents · 99% above the NSW rate (212.3) · higher than 87% of NSW suburbs
Car theft
237.6 incidents per 100,000 residents · 39% above the NSW rate (171.2) · higher than 74% of NSW suburbs
Theft from cars
475.2 incidents per 100,000 residents · 61% above the NSW rate (295.4) · higher than 83% of NSW suburbs
Theft from homes
184.8 incidents per 100,000 residents · 6% below the NSW rate (196.2) · higher than 64% of NSW suburbs
Malicious property damage
580.8 incidents per 100,000 residents · 5% above the NSW rate (553.8) · higher than 66% of NSW suburbs
What's coming to Sawtell
The ABS area covering Sawtell (Sawtell - Boambee) is projected to go from 20,119 residents (2021) to 21,157 by 2041 — a change of +5.2%, passing 20,692 by 2031.
